Journey to Hong Kong's Extravagance,The City's Top Hotels

The Ritz-Carlton, Hong Kong: Perched on the upper floors of the International Commerce Centre, The Ritz-Carlton, Best Hotel In Hong Kong, stands as a beacon of luxury. With its panoramic views of Victoria Harbour, lavish rooms and suites, and a two Michelin-starred restaurant, Tin Lung Heen, this hotel promises an unforgettable stay.

The Peninsula Hong Kong: A true Hong Kong institution, The Peninsula has been a symbol of timeless elegance for over nine decades. Located in Tsim Sha Tsui, this iconic hotel boasts grand colonial architecture, world-class spa facilities, and the legendary Peninsula Afternoon Tea. It’s a blend of history and modern luxury.

Four Seasons Hotel Hong Kong: Situated on Hong Kong Island, Top Hotel in Hong Kong the Four Seasons offers a sleek and contemporary experience. Its Michelin three-star restaurant, Lung King Heen, is a culinary paradise for dim sum lovers. Guests can also unwind at the infinity pool while gazing at the city’s skyline.

The Upper House: Nestled amidst the bustling streets of Admiralty, The Upper House offers a tranquil escape. Its minimalist design and spacious rooms exude calmness and serenity. The hotel’s Café Gray Deluxe serves delectable European cuisine with panoramic views of the city.

Mandarin Oriental, Hong Kong: With a prime location in the heart of Central, the Mandarin Oriental has been pampering guests for decades. The Michelin-starred Man Wah restaurant serves authentic Cantonese cuisine, while the Mandarin Spa provides rejuvenation and relaxation.

A Tale of Hong Kong Disneyland Hotels

Discover the magic of Hong Kong Disneyland Hotels, where enchantment awaits visitors eager to immerse themselves in the world of Disney. These hotels are an integral part of the larger Hong Kong Disneyland Resort, offering a unique blend of Disney charm and top-notch hospitality. Let’s explore some key Disney hotels:

Hong Kong Disneyland Hotel: This flagship hotel combines Victorian elegance with Disney’s charm, nestled amid lush gardens and facing the South China Sea. Themed rooms, enchanted dining, Disney-themed spa treatments, and an iconic Mickey Mouse-shaped pool make this a magical retreat.

Disney Explorers Lodge: For adventure seekers, this hotel is a treasure trove themed around exploration. Its four wings represent different corners of the world, offering a journey of discovery, international cuisine, and serene gardens.

Disney’s Hollywood Hotel: Step into the glitz and glamour of classic Hollywood at this vibrant hotel. Enjoy a playful atmosphere, a piano-shaped pool, lively restaurants, and outdoor movies under the stars. Convenient shuttle service to the theme park is provided.

Toy Story Hotel: Inspired by the beloved Toy Story franchise, this hotel exudes playfulness and whimsy. The lobby features life-sized Toy Story characters, and rooms are adorned with Toy Story-themed decor. Sunnyside Café adds a dash of Disney magic to your dining experience.

Staying at Hong Kong Disneyland Hotels not only grants easy access to the theme park but also ensures a complete Disney experience from morning to night. Whether you’re with family, friends, or as a couple, these hotels create lasting magical memories.

Budget-Friendly Affordable Stays in the Hong Kong Resort

Silka Tsuen Wan: Nestled in Tsuen Wan, this hotel offers comfortable rooms at an affordable rate. Its proximity to the city center and convenient transportation options make it a practical choice for budget-conscious travelers.

Ibis Hong Kong Central and Sheung Wan: A well-regarded budget hotel chain, conveniently located in Sheung Wan near Central. Expect clean and cozy rooms that won’t break the bank.

Eco Tree Hotel: Situated in Jordan, this hotel offers budget-friendly rates and excellent access to public transportation, making it an ideal pick for those on a budget.

Mini Hotel Causeway Bay: In the heart of vibrant Causeway Bay, this hotel offers compact and stylish rooms at competitive rates. It’s the perfect choice for those who want to immerse themselves in the city’s bustling atmosphere.

Yesinn @Causeway Bay: If you’re seeking affordable hostel-style lodging, Yesinn in Causeway Bay is a popular option. It provides dormitory and private rooms at budget-friendly prices.
